|  | /* | 
|  | * This code allows the net stack to make use of a DMA engine for | 
|  | * skb to iovec copies. | 
|  | */ | 
|  |  | 
|  | #include <linux/dmaengine.h> | 
|  | #include <linux/socket.h> | 
|  | #include <linux/rtnetlink.h> /* for BUG_TRAP */ | 
|  | #include <net/tcp.h> | 
|  | #include <net/netdma.h> | 
|  |  | 
|  | #define NET_DMA_DEFAULT_COPYBREAK 4096 | 
|  |  | 
|  | int sysctl_tcp_dma_copybreak = NET_DMA_DEFAULT_COPYBREAK; | 
|  |  | 
|  | /** | 
|  | *	dma_skb_copy_datagram_iovec - Copy a datagram to an iovec. | 
|  | *	@skb - buffer to copy | 
|  | *	@offset - offset in the buffer to start copying from | 
|  | *	@iovec - io vector to copy to | 
|  | *	@len - amount of data to copy from buffer to iovec | 
|  | *	@pinned_list - locked iovec buffer data | 
|  | * | 
|  | *	Note: the iovec is modified during the copy. | 
|  | */ | 
|  | int dma_skb_copy_datagram_iovec(struct dma_chan *chan, | 
|  | struct sk_buff *skb, int offset, struct iovec *to, | 
|  | size_t len, struct dma_pinned_list *pinned_list) | 
|  | { | 
|  | int start = skb_headlen(skb); | 
|  | int i, copy = start - offset; | 
|  | dma_cookie_t cookie = 0; | 
|  |  | 
|  | /* Copy header. */ | 
|  | if (copy > 0) { | 
|  | if (copy > len) | 
|  | copy = len; | 
|  | cookie = dma_memcpy_to_iovec(chan, to, pinned_list, | 
|  | skb->data + offset, copy); | 
|  | if (cookie < 0) | 
|  | goto fault; | 
|  | len -= copy; | 
|  | if (len == 0) | 
|  | goto end; | 
|  | offset += copy; | 
|  | } | 
|  |  | 
|  | /* Copy paged appendix. Hmm... why does this look so complicated? */ | 
|  | for (i = 0; i < skb_shinfo(skb)->nr_frags; i++) { | 
|  | int end; | 
|  |  | 
|  | BUG_TRAP(start <= offset + len); | 
|  |  | 
|  | end = start + skb_shinfo(skb)->frags[i].size; | 
|  | copy = end - offset; | 
|  | if ((copy = end - offset) > 0) { | 
|  | skb_frag_t *frag = &skb_shinfo(skb)->frags[i]; | 
|  | struct page *page = frag->page; | 
|  |  | 
|  | if (copy > len) | 
|  | copy = len; | 
|  |  | 
|  | cookie = dma_memcpy_pg_to_iovec(chan, to, pinned_list, page, | 
|  | frag->page_offset + offset - start, copy); | 
|  | if (cookie < 0) | 
|  | goto fault; | 
|  | len -= copy; | 
|  | if (len == 0) | 
|  | goto end; | 
|  | offset += copy; | 
|  | } | 
|  | start = end; | 
|  | } | 
|  |  | 
|  | if (skb_shinfo(skb)->frag_list) { | 
|  | struct sk_buff *list = skb_shinfo(skb)->frag_list; | 
|  |  | 
|  | for (; list; list = list->next) { | 
|  | int end; | 
|  |  | 
|  | BUG_TRAP(start <= offset + len); | 
|  |  | 
|  | end = start + list->len; | 
|  | copy = end - offset; | 
|  | if (copy > 0) { | 
|  | if (copy > len) | 
|  | copy = len; | 
|  | cookie = dma_skb_copy_datagram_iovec(chan, list, | 
|  | offset - start, to, copy, | 
|  | pinned_list); | 
|  | if (cookie < 0) | 
|  | goto fault; | 
|  | len -= copy; | 
|  | if (len == 0) | 
|  | goto end; | 
|  | offset += copy; | 
|  | } | 
|  | start = end; | 
|  | } | 
|  | } | 
|  |  | 
|  | end: | 
|  | if (!len) { | 
|  | skb->dma_cookie = cookie; | 
|  | return cookie; | 
|  | } | 
|  |  | 
|  | fault: | 
|  | return -EFAULT; | 
|  | } |
